Transaction 853b77a3fd497084906825d2837ce1f766995d4af25732b3f524e0f70970d4f0

37 Input
2 Outputs
  • 853b77a3fd497084906825d2837ce1f766995d4af25732b3f524e0f70970d4f0:0
  • value  77188687
    address  3LtDJAnHumRAj4opRiyJ7q6aAgx9Tk8ARK
  • 853b77a3fd497084906825d2837ce1f766995d4af25732b3f524e0f70970d4f0:1
  • value  687430580
    address  3BMEXvhVYCctpdZ4wjsJx67oWtMVxRUEVY